OHIO -- A Republican Ohio lawmaker is making waves after taking to Facebook and urging state residents to stop getting tested for the novel coronavirus.

State Rep. Nino Vitale, R-Urbana, posted the message after Gov. Mike DeWine mandated residents in several Ohio counties wear face masks in public.

Vitale's message reads, in part: “Are you tired of living in a dictatorship yet? This is what happens when people go crazy and get tested. STOP GETTING TESTED!”

Vitale seems to be suggesting COVID-19 testing does not accurately reflect the severity of the virus outbreak, writing: “Is it giving the government an excuse to claim something is happening that is not happening at the magnitude they say it is happening. Have you noticed they don’t talk about deaths anymore, just cases? And they never talk about recoveries. They just keep adding to the numbers they have been feeding us from over 3 months ago!”

In another post, Vitale questions the effectiveness of facial coverings in preventing the spread of COVID-19.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ention and other health agencies have stressed that testing is an important component of getting a handle on the virus.

Of the more than 130,000 Americans who have died due to COVID-19, nearly 3,000 were from Ohio.
